Roof hole patching services involve repairing openings or damages in a roof’s surface to restore its integrity and prevent further issues. These services typically include identifying the source of the hole, removing damaged roofing material, and installing new patches or coverings that match the existing roof. The goal is to create a seamless repair that stops leaks, protects the interior of the property, and extends the lifespan of the roof. Skilled contractors use appropriate materials and techniques to ensure the patch is durable and weather-resistant, helping to maintain the overall strength of the roof.
This service is especially important for resolving problems caused by storm damage, fallen debris, or aging roofing materials. Holes in the roof can lead to water leaks, mold growth, and structural deterioration if left unaddressed. Patching a hole quickly can prevent more extensive and costly repairs down the line. Homeowners often seek roof hole patching when they notice water stains on ceilings, visible damage after a storm, or suspect that a previous repair was not fully effective. Addressing these issues promptly can help protect the interior spaces and maintain the property's value.

The overview below groups typical Roof Hole Patching proj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Edmond, OK.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or roof hole patches gener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the size and location of the hole.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Moderate Repairs - larger or more complex patching jobs can cost between $600 and $1,200. These projects often involve additional materials or labor, which can increase the overall price. Many local contractors handle jobs in this range successfully.
Severe Damage or Multiple Patches - extensive repairs may range from $1,200 to $3,000, especially if multiple areas need attention or the damage is widespread. Such projects are less common but necessary for significant roof issues.
Full Roof Replacement - when patching is insufficient, full replacement costs typically start around $5,000 and can go higher depending on the roof size and materials.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into this higher cost bracket.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es roof holes that need patching? Roof holes can result from weather damage, fallen debris, or aging materials that weaken over time.
How do local contractors patch roof holes? Contractors typically inspect the damage, clean the area, and apply appropriate patching materials to restore roof integrity.
Are roof hole patches permanent repairs? Patching can be durable, but the longevity depends on the extent of damage and proper installation by experienced service providers.
What types of materials are used for roof hole patching? Common materials include asphalt patches, rubber patches, or sealants, chosen based on roof type and size of the hole.
